Abstract

Complementary Foods for Mother's Milk (MP-ASI) are foods or drinks containing substances that are given to infants or children aged 6-24 months. The provision of MP-ASI has not been achieved which is influenced by several factors such as knowledge, mother's health and occupation, MP-ASI advertising, health workers, culture and socio-economics. This study aims to determine the factors associated with the provision of complementary feeding (MP-ASI) too early in Sifaoroasi Village, South Nias Regency in 2022. This research is a quantitative research with cross sectional approach. This research was conducted from September 12, 2022 to September 24, 2022. The population is 24 people. Sampling using total sampling with a total sample of 24 people. Data processing starts from editing, coding, tabulating, entry and data processing. Data analysis using chi-square test The results showed that the age factor with a value of p = 0.208 > a = 0.05, the education factor with a value of p = 0.839 > a = 0.05 and the work factor with a value of p = 0.883 > a = 0.05. While the parity factor with a value of p = 0.001 > a = 0.05, knowledge with a value of p = 0.004 > a = 0.05 and the attitude factor with a value of p = 0.007 > a = 0.05. So it can be concluded that the parity factor, knowledge and attitude related to the provision of complementary feeding (MP-ASI) too early, while the maternal characteristics factor was not related to the provision of complementary feeding (MP-ASI) too early.
